Abstract :
Presents a human-like, non-photorealistic rendering approach. A typical process of how human engineers learn to paint a technical illustration is as follows. First, they are trained in how to paint separate primitives, such as cubes and spheres, and accordingly accumulate empirical drawing principles and skills during their continuous practice, and finally they can freely express complicated shapes by composing the related primitives´ drawings together. We manage to mimic this human-like approach by embedding established illustration rules into primitives´ lighting models and drawing algorithms, and implement it in an illustration system called RETOUCH
